个人简介


孙宁,女,博士,现为河海大学物联网工程学院计算机系副教授,硕士生导师。IEEE会员、中国计算机学会会员。

主要研究领域:物联网理论与技术、网络安全、云计算与大数据。
主持参与国家级、省级自然科学基金项目3项,以及常州市科技项目和横向课题等多项;发表30余篇SCI/EI检索论文,并获得QSHINE2016大会最佳论文奖;授权发明专利5项,软著1项;出版教材1部。长期担任IEEE Network Magazine、Computer Networks、Journal of Computer Network and Applications等国际期刊审稿专家。积极投身教学改革与学生创新工作,现主持国家级精品在线课程《云计算技术与应用》1门,指导学生多次获得中国大学生软件杯、服务外包大赛等多项奖项。

教育经历


1996.09-2000.07,山东轻工业学院,机械设计与制造,工学学士学位
2006.03-2008.02,韩国忠北国立大学,计算机科学,工学硕士学位
2008.03-2013.02,韩国忠北国立大学,计算机科学,工学博士学位


工作经历


2001.02-2005.07,山东鲁能慧通科技有限责任公司,软件开发
2013.02-2013.07,韩国忠北国立大学网络安全研究室,学术研究
2013.07-,河海大学物联网工程学院,教学科研
